School meaning

Word: School

How to pronounce: skuːl

Noun

Definitions:

1. An institution for educating children.

Example sentences: "Ryder's children did not go to school at all"

2. Any institution at which instruction is given in a particular discipline.

Example sentences: "A dancing school"

3. A group of people, particularly writers, artists, or philosophers, sharing the same or similar ideas, methods, or style.

Example sentences: "The Frankfurt school of critical theory"

Transitive verb

Definitions:

1. Send to school; educate.

Example sentences: "He was schooled in Boston"

Noun

Definitions:

1. A large group of fish or sea mammals.

Example sentences: "A school of dolphins"

Intransitive verb

Definitions:

1. (of fish or sea mammals) form a large group.
